Segment geometry definition is a mathematical and conceptual framework used to understand and represent spatial relationships between objects. It involves dividing a continuous space into smaller, manageable segments, or polygons, and defining their properties, such as boundaries, lengths, and orientations. This method allows for the identification of patterns, trends, and anomalies within spatial data, facilitating meaningful insights and analysis. For instance, in urban planning, segment geometry definition can help identify areas of high population density, transportation hubs, or environmental hazards.

In conclusion, segment geometry definition is a critical component of spatial studies, enabling accurate representation, analysis, and decision-making in various fields. As technology advances and data becomes increasingly available, understanding segment geometry definition and its applications is essential for professionals and policymakers alike. By breaking down boundaries between different domains and disciplines, segment geometry definition contributes to a more informed and data-driven approach to spatial analysis.

In recent years, spatial analysis has become a crucial aspect of various fields, from urban planning to natural resource management. With the increasing use of geographic information systems (GIS) and the rise of location-based services, segment geometry definition has emerged as a critical component of spatial studies. As technology advances, it is essential to understand the fundamental concepts of segment geometry definition and its significance in various applications.
